java如何获取数据库的库

java如何获取数据库的库

作者:Joshua Lee发布时间:2026-02-14阅读时长:0 分钟阅读次数:2

用户关注问题

Q
如何在Java中连接数据库?

我想通过Java程序连接数据库,请问该怎么实现?需要哪些步骤?

A

Java连接数据库的基本步骤

要在Java中连接数据库,首先需要加载数据库驱动,然后通过JDBC的DriverManager获取数据库连接,接着使用Connection对象创建Statement或PreparedStatement执行SQL语句,最后关闭连接以释放资源。确保数据库地址、用户名和密码正确。

Q
Java中如何获取数据库中的所有库名?

我想通过Java代码查询数据库服务器上的所有数据库名称,有什么方法可以实现?

A

通过Java和JDBC查询所有数据库名称

可以通过JDBC执行特定的SQL语句来获取数据库列表。例如,在MySQL中执行查询SHOW DATABASES;,然后遍历ResultSet即可获取所有数据库名称。不同数据库管理系统的获取方式略有不同,需根据所用数据库选择合适的SQL语句。

Q
用Java获取特定数据库的表名怎么做?

连接到数据库后,我想列出该库中所有的表名。Java中有什么API可以实现此功能?

A

使用DatabaseMetaData获取数据库表信息

连接数据库后,可以通过Connection对象的getMetaData()方法获取DatabaseMetaData对象,调用其getTables()方法可以获得指定数据库中所有表的信息,进而遍历得到所有表名。此方法适用于多种关系型数据库。